Cheqa Gorg (Persian: چغاگرگ, also Romanized as Cheqā Gorg, Chagha Gorg, Cheghā Gorg, and Choqāgorg)[1] is a village in Borborud-e Gharbi Rural District, in the Central District of Aligudarz County, Lorestan Province, Iran. At the 2006 census, its population was 173, in 33 families.[2]
